I've always liked old school punk music for aerobics. The Ramones, The Clash, The Sex Pistols with some early Elvis Costello, The Jam, X, Buzzcocks, even some Blondie. The songs are short, the tempos are fast, and the energy is infectious. Gets the heart pumpin'!0

I have several playlist set up for each work out with different music that just works with what I'm doing Examples;
Bike playlist - which are mainly fast beat pop music such as- Scream & Shout (Will.i.am) I Cry (Flo Rida) Dance Again (Jenifer Lopez) ect.
Running - I like music that is fast but also music that has meaning in their lyrics- Little Talks (of Monsters and Men), Lightning Crashes (Live), Proud (Heather Small) , Collide (Leona Lewis) ect
Elliptical - It's usually spanish - Danza Kuduro (Don Omar) Virtual Diva (Don Omar), Hasta Abajo (Don Omar) ect
Training - mostly pop but with rap or strong beats - Hall of Fame (the Script) Jump (Rihanna) Turnin Me on (Keri Hilson) Say I (Christina Milian) Give it up to me (Sean Paul)
I hope that helps.0 -

jog.fm is a website where you can type in the minute mile you are running/walking/biking (or what pace your working towards) and it will tell you what songs are at that pace! Might give you some ideas!0
